Bromcom Computers Plc is looking for a Technical GRC Analyst to enhance our governance, risk, compliance, and security assurance processes. The role involves operating within a dynamic EdTech SaaS environment and ensuring compliance with policies, especially GDPR.
In this role, you will be responsible for:
- Performing risk assessments
- Coordinating security activities
- Maintaining documentation to support audits
Candidates should have a background in IT risk or compliance within technology sectors, strong organisational skills, and familiarity with compliance monitoring tools.
